identifying the right communities

To get started, small business owners need to identify online communities that are relevant to their niche. This can involve searching for social media groups, forums, or specialized platforms where people discuss topics related to their products or services. It’s essential to choose communities that are active and have a sizable number of members. Joining a community with only a handful of participants may not be worth the effort.

participating in discussions

Once a relevant community is found, the next step is to participate in discussions. This means contributing valuable insights, answering questions, and sharing experiences. The goal is to provide helpful information and demonstrate expertise, rather than simply promoting one’s business. By doing so, entrepreneurs can establish themselves as trusted authorities in their field and attract potential customers.

building relationships

Building relationships with community members is critical to growing a customer base. This involves engaging with people individually, responding to their comments, and showing genuine interest in their needs and concerns. As relationships develop, business owners can begin to introduce their products or services in a non-intrusive way, highlighting how they can help solve problems or meet specific needs.

  • Be authentic and transparent in all interactions
  • Listen actively and respond thoughtfully to comments and messages
  • Show appreciation for feedback and suggestions from community members

measuring success

Evaluating the effectiveness of online community engagement is essential to understanding its impact on the business. This can involve tracking website traffic, monitoring social media analytics, or using other metrics to measure the number of leads generated from community participation. By analyzing these metrics, entrepreneurs can refine their strategy and make adjustments as needed.

avoiding common mistakes

Some common mistakes small business owners make when engaging with online communities include being too promotional or spammy. This can lead to being banned from the community or damaging one’s reputation. It’s also important to avoid coming across as insincere or trying to manipulate others for personal gain. Instead, focus on providing value and building genuine relationships.

  • Avoid overpromoting products or services
  • Don’t engage in arguments or conflicts with other community members
  • Be respectful and considerate of others’ opinions and perspectives
